Sunderland manager Roy Keane has vowed not to repeat last summer's mistakes in the transfer market.
Following promotion to the Premier League, Keane spent heavily in an attempt to assemble a squad capable of avoiding relegation.
Though the Black Cats are on course for survival, several of the Irishman's signings, such as Greg Halford and Russell Anderson, have had no impact at the Stadium of Light.
Keane has acknowledged the errors he made 12 months ago, but is confident he is now in a better position when he looks for new signings at the end of the season.
"I made mistakes last summer," said Keane. "We did a lot of deals before getting back to pre-season [training].
"I won't be making that mistake again. I won't be making 30 or 40 phone calls every day like I did last summer.
